بعض التعليمات البرمجية للحصول على قراصنة الإنجاز!
التعليمات أدناه!
انتقل إلى جهاز الكمبيوتر المنزلي واكتب هذا:
nano devmenu.ns
الآن ما عليك سوى نسخ الكود من هذا الدليل ولصقه فيه وحفظه.
ثم يمكنك الانتقال إلى جهاز الكمبيوتر في المنزل مرة أخرى وتشغيله:
قم بتشغيل devmenu.ns
الآن يجب أن ترى أنك حصلت على الإنجاز!
لا تنس أن تقتل النص باستخدام:
kill devmenu.ns
هذا هو الكود المهم للحصول على الإنجاز:
/** @param {NS} ns **/ let getProps = (obj) => Object.entries(obj).find(entry => entry[0].startsWith("__reactProps"))[1].children.props; let hasPlayer = (obj) => { try { return getProps(obj).player ? true : false; } catch(ex) { return false; } } export async function main(ns) { let boxes = Array.from(eval("document").querySelectorAll("[class*=MuiBox-root]")); let box = boxes.find(x => hasPlayer(x)); if(box) { ns.tprintf("INFO className: \"" + box.className + "\""); let props = getProps(box); // get a 10% cash bonus props.player.money = props.player.money * 1.1; // open dev menu props.router.toDevMenu(); } }
المزيد من الأدلة:
- Bitburner: البرنامج النصي لإدارة السيارات في وقت مبكر من Hacknet
- Bitburner: برنامج حساب الوقت (كيفية الحصول على الوقت)
- Bitburner: أتمتة عقد Hacknet
- Bitburner: برنامج Combat Gang Management Script (تلقائي بالكامل)
- Bitburner: دليل اللعبة المبكر (مجاني المفسد)